At the SCO Defence Ministers’ meeting in Qingdao, Rajnath Singh addressed the critical issues of peace and security. He underscored the transformation the world is undergoing and the challenges to multilateral systems. Without directly naming Pakistan, Singh condemned countries that utilize cross-border terrorism and harbor terrorists. He emphasized the importance of collective action and unity to counter radicalization, extremism, and terrorism. Singh also mentioned India’s stance on Operation Sindoor, highlighting the nation’s right to defend itself against terrorist threats. He also expressed gratitude to China for hosting the meeting and congratulated Belarus on joining the SCO.
